Information

1-2. The Fluke Model 341Ä and Model 343A' DC Voltage Calibrators provide dc voltages of 0 to 1100 volts in three ranges. Voltages are selected by eleven-position decade switches, which provide in-line, digital readout of the instrument output voltage. The Model 341A employs six-dial readout» with 1 ppm resolution, and the Model 343A employs seven-dial readout, with 0.1 ppm resolution. 1-3. A controlled current limiter, a fixed current limiter, and an electronic crowbar circuit provide protection against instrument malfunction and operator error. Output current or voltage, depending on function desired, are continuously monitored by a front panel meter. 1-4. The instruments are designed for rack-mount installation, using the mounting brackets supplied, and are equipped with resilient feet and tilt-down bail for field or bench use.
